In 2020, we received funding from The National Lottery Community Fund to develop a Young People’s Hub at the base in Beeches Road, Loughborough. Young volunteers have been taking part in a range of water-based educational, environmental and heritage projects; gaining new experiences, learning new skills and having fun. While enjoyable, the young people have gained greater confidence, self-belief and important collaboration skills.
We have enjoyed teaming up with other local organisations and groups and have another action-packed schedule of events throughout 2024. Watch out for exciting updates over the coming months, along with ways you can become involved.

Laura Sherlock, Project Lead - Leicester & Leicestershire Enterprise Partnership (LLEP)
Angie and all the team at Peter Le Marchant Trust have provided invaluable experiences to young people with SEND in Leicester and Leicestershire, demonstrating to them that even if they are unlikely (now or in the future) to have paid employment, they can meaningfully employ their time with brilliant community initiatives like volunteering on the waterways. The feedback we have had from schools has been outstanding and the fact that schools are falling over themselves to book in for 2024 and beyond, speaks volumes of the activities Angie runs.
